Understanding Your Bmw E36 Electrical Wiring Diagram
At its core, a Bmw E36 Electrical Wiring Diagram is a schematic representation of all the electrical components and circuits within your car. It details how wires connect different parts, from the headlights and dashboard indicators to the engine control unit and power windows. These diagrams are crucial for diagnosing electrical problems, performing repairs, and even for enthusiasts who wish to understand their car on a deeper level. They are typically organized by system (e.g., ignition system, lighting system, comfort system) to make them easier to follow.
Using a Bmw E36 Electrical Wiring Diagram effectively requires some basic understanding of electrical symbols and terminology. You'll encounter symbols representing fuses, relays, switches, motors, sensors, and more. Each wire is usually identified by a color code and a number, which helps in tracing specific circuits.
